Default Speedometer ?s

so my gauge has worked since i had my car, my question is how can i determine if it the cable broke or the gauge. Also i have no cruise control now cause of the grant steering wheel installed, do i get the cable for cruise control or the one without?

well if you dont want cruise control, you can just order the cable without it...

you can test the gauge by taking out the cluster and spinning the nub that the speedo cable goes into.
